Hydraena quadricurvipes

Perkins, 1980

Hydraena quadricurvipes is a of minute moss beetle in the Hydraenidae, described by Perkins in 1980. It belongs to the subgenus Holcohydraena within the diverse Hydraena, commonly known as long-palped water beetles. The species has been recorded from several states in the eastern United States. Distribution

Recorded from Alabama, Georgia, Indiana, and Maryland in the United States.
